Last year I shot the Striker out of my Franchi, 3in. Hevi #4. The pattern at 30yds was loose at best. Wasn't happy at all.
I run it in a Versamax, the constriction is .670. Patterns great with Longbeard #6, I shoot the 3.5 inch shell. I only shoot lead shot. This is a good choke at a decent price in my opinion.
